The third National Mikey Powell Memorial Family Fund (NMPMFF) grant round closed on 7 June 2021. In this round the assessment team also acknowledged the easing of Covid-19 restrictions with a one-off gift to all successful applicants.


We successfully allocated £8,150 in grants to 19 families/campaigns in the third round. This also included uplift awards from the newly established Family Crisis Fund.
